Can anyone say if any of these bikes are any good. They sell at
auction for 40-50 pounds. Sorry about the caps (cut and paste job).

24V A Peugeot 21 speed gents mountain bike with alloy wheels and
Shimano GS gears.

25v An Apollo gents Manic mountain bike with 18 speed Shimano gears
and alloy wheels.

29V Universal Rapid Reactor gents mountain cycle in black

31V A Shogun Trail Breaker gents mountain cycle in black.



These four don't have suspension and are thus worth the effort. Avoid
all the others like the plague.

thanks, what is so bad about suspension on a bike ?


The items that get supplied in the £50 range tend to be engineered for
show-room 'gee-whiz', rather than engineered to be capable of doing
the job.

They'll basically make pedalling the bike harder, without giving you
the advantages decent suspension will provide.
